Comparison of Different Grades (J55/K55/N80/L80/C90/P110) for API 5CT Oil Producing Tube

API 5CT oil producing tube seamless steel tubing is a critical component in the oil and gas industry. It is used for drilling, production, and transportation of oil and gas from the wellbore to the surface. The API 5CT specification sets the standards for seamless steel tubing used in the industry, with different grades available to suit various applications.

One of the most commonly used grades of API 5CT oil producing tube seamless steel tubing is J55. J55 is a low Carbon Steel grade that is suitable for shallow wells with low pressure and low to medium production rates. It has good weldability and is commonly used in casing and tubing applications.

Another popular grade is K55, which is similar to J55 but has a higher tensile strength. K55 is often used in casing and tubing applications where higher mechanical properties are required. It is also suitable for sour service environments where the tubing is exposed to corrosive elements.

N80 is a higher grade of API 5CT oil producing tube seamless steel tubing that is commonly used in medium to high pressure and high production rate wells. N80 has a higher tensile strength and better resistance to corrosion compared to J55 and K55. It is often used in casing and tubing applications where the tubing is exposed to harsh environments.

L80 is another high-grade API 5CT oil producing tube seamless steel tubing that is commonly used in high pressure and high temperature wells. L80 has a higher tensile strength and better resistance to corrosion compared to N80. It is often used in casing and tubing applications where the tubing is exposed to extreme conditions.

C90 is a premium grade of API 5CT oil producing tube seamless steel tubing that is commonly used in high pressure and high temperature wells. C90 has a higher tensile strength and better resistance to corrosion compared to L80. It is often used in casing and tubing applications where the tubing is exposed to severe conditions.

P110 is the highest grade of API 5CT oil producing tube seamless steel tubing that is commonly used in ultra-high pressure and high temperature wells. P110 has the highest tensile strength and best resistance to corrosion compared to all other grades. It is often used in casing and tubing applications where the tubing is exposed to extreme conditions.

In conclusion, the choice of grade for API 5CT oil producing tube seamless steel tubing depends on the specific requirements of the well and the conditions it will be exposed to. J55 and K55 are suitable for shallow wells with low pressure, while N80, L80, C90, and P110 are suitable for high pressure and high temperature wells. Each grade offers different mechanical properties and resistance to corrosion, allowing operators to select the most appropriate grade for their specific application.
